Justice Salon

“The big task in the 21st century is that we move to let love be the power in which we organize every facet of society—every facet of society." -- Rev. James Lawson

Join us for our August edition of the Justice Salon, as we continue learning and equipping ourselves together for the work of faith-rooted justice. We'll touch on opportunities for joining our immigration/asylum accompaniment and advocacy work, our emerging eco-environmental justice work, and participating as a congregation in upcoming public actions organized by NOAH (Nashville Organized for Action and Hope).
